Top Cement Companies in Gujarat

Gujarat, a state in India, is known for its thriving cement industry. Several cement companies have a significant presence in Gujarat due to its favorable business environment and abundant availability of raw materials. Here are some of the top cement companies in Gujarat:

  1. UltraTech Cement Ltd: UltraTech Cement, a part of the Aditya Birla Group, is the largest cement producer in India. It has multiple cement plants in Gujarat, including the largest integrated cement plant in the state located in Kovaya, near Rajula.
  2. Ambuja Cements Ltd: Ambuja Cements, a part of the LafargeHolcim Group, is one of the leading cement manufacturers in India. It has a cement plant in Kodinar, Gujarat, which is one of the largest single-location cement plants in the country.
  3. Sanghi Industries Ltd: Sanghi Industries is a prominent cement manufacturer based in Gujarat. It operates a state-of-the-art cement plant in Abdasa, Kutch, with a production capacity of 4.1 million tonnes per annum.
